I changed over to an Edelbrock RPM intake on my 440, made a piece to extend the old throttle cable out of some scrap carb parts, used the old throttle cable bracket that was at the wrong angle to get home from my dad's place. Ordered a new throttle cable bracket from Mancini for the taller RPM intake, then realized the bloody cable is still too short. There are 2 options that I've found, one from Mancini that is $79, and one from Year One that is $35.00, they seem to be similar. Tell me why I'm buying the $79 one from Mancini? Vehicle is a '66 Belvedere I, auto with a 440.

I just recently went to install a new throttle cable on a 70 383 R.R. from OER, & the cable was too short. It was supposed to be for that car. Ended up re-installing the factory cable. (thankfully it was still in good condition) Mancini prices seem kind of high, but you will probably get a good, quality piece. I don't know about Year One anymore. If Rick Ehrenberg has one, I would get one from him. He is a very, very knowledgeable Mopar guy. He has articles at Allpar & Mopar Action.
